Problem
Conventional techniques require printers to have a special function to identify users and determine whether successive print jobs are from the same user, making it difficult to implement banner page insertion without equipping printers with additional functionality.
Innovation Solution
A non-transitory computer-readable storage medium storing a program that allows an information processing apparatus to communicate with a printer, using accumulated sheet numbers and identification information to determine whether to insert a banner page between print jobs, thereby eliminating the need for special printer functionality.

A non-transitory computer readable storage medium storing a set of program instructions for an information processing apparatus including: a processor; a communication interface; and a storage. The set of program instructions, when executed by the processor, causes the information processing apparatus to perform: acquire a print job; determining whether a second accumulated sheet number acquired from the printer is equal to a first accumulated sheet number acquired from the storage; when the second accumulated sheet number is different from the first accumulated sheet number, transmitting a first print job; and when the second accumulated sheet number is equal to the first accumulated sheet number, transmitting a second print job. The first print job includes a print command to insert the separating sheet for separating the acquired print job from another print job, while the second print job does not include the print command to insert the separating sheet.
